The name Othusitswe originates from the Tswana language, a Bantu language spoken in Southern Africa. It combines elements meaning 'chosen' or 'selected', often given to a child believed to be specially chosen or destined for greatness. Historically, names in Tswana culture carry significant spiritual and social meaning, reflecting hopes and identity.

Cultural Significance of Othusitswe

In Tswana culture, names like Othusitswe reflect deep cultural values emphasizing destiny and the spiritual importance of a child. Such names are often given with the belief that the child is chosen by ancestors or fate to fulfill a specific role or bring honor to the family. Historically, this naming tradition strengthens communal bonds and individual identity within the tribe.
